If I bought it, it would be for the movement only. Lugs have splitting in the gold fill and I junk cases like that Too me. it's a movement purchase only and not worth a 3rd of the asking price Stay away from it. DON
Movement dates from 1954-55 with a 14 million serial number. Dial looks to be original. Case has been polished so hard it looks like a melted ice cube. As a result, it is worn through in spots. Price is way too high. gatorcpa
